When experiencing some sort of personal crisis, one would offer a sacrifice to the deity, as a means of getting Gods attention, and then recite a psalm of individual lament, asking for divine favor and rescue. Modern Bibles generally contain 150 psalms, based on the form found in the traditional Jewish text, which is called the Masoretic text. These internal divisions suggest that the book of Psalms should be understood as a second-level collection: a gathering together of previously independent collections of psalms. Furthermore, the same process of textual fluidity that we see with the scope of the book of Psalms as a whole is evident also in these superscriptions: while the Hebrew text ascribes 73 psalms to David, the Greek version ascribes 85 to him. In this light, the fluidity we see in the textual tradition should not be surprising. He was interested not in the question of the composition of any given psalm, but rather in what he called the Sitz im Leben, the setting in life, of each broader category. In the story of Davids life, he is known to have been a musician: in 1 Samuel 16, he famously plays the lyre to soothe Sauls troubled spirit.
